Layered with variations of swift gestural strokes in vibrant colours, the artist constructs a rich variation of forms in this playful and exuberant piece. Rafiee Ghani’s colourful palette and expressive brushwork results in a highly distinguished style which communicate human emotions that transcend cultures. In Purple Hearts, the artist portrays beautifully arranged purple flowers amidst the chaotic settings that enhance the ambiance of the scene.
Rafiee Ghani is one of the most well-travelled and cosmopolitan artists, on land, traversing central and western Asia, besides Europe and the United States, all adding to his visual colour bank which he synthesizes in his works. He got a degree overseas first, at the De Vrije Academic, Voor Bildeende Kunst, The Hague (1980) before returning to retake his Diploma, Mara Institute of Technology, 1985, (majoring in Printmaking trained under Ponirin Amin). He followed up with a MA (Fine Prints) at the Manchester Polytechnic, England, in 1987. His accolades include the Minor Award in the Salon Malaysia (1991) and twice in the Young Contemporary Artists competition (1984 and 1985). He also won 2nd Prize in the Malaysian Art Open in 1994. His artwork prices skyrocketed at foreign auction houses in recent years. Rafiee was featured for a month at the prestigious Nou Gallery, Taipei near end of 2018.
